Embodiment 1
[0034] Such as image 3 As shown, the present invention provides an inductor shielding ring comprising: a planar spiral inductor 1 and a shielding ring 3 .
[0035] In this embodiment, the planar spiral inductor 1 is located at the center of the shielding ring 3, and the distance between the metal inner ring of the shielding ring 3 and the metal outer ring of the planar spiral inductor 1 is d 2 20mm to 50mm. The shielding ring 3 in the prior art requires a relatively large safe distance from the inductor (d 1 >80mm) can avoid reducing the performance of the inductor and ensure that the accuracy of the inductor model is not affected. However, when the safety distance is reduced to 20mm-50mm in the present invention, the inductance still has better performance, and the inductance model is not affected.
